Employment Solicitor NQ - 4yrs Chester
Our client is the country's leading specialist Employment Law company, offering a full Advisory service to clients on a nationwide scale. In line with continued growth and planned expansion they are currently looking to extend their Employment Law Advisory team with the addition of an experienced Employment Lawyer.
The successful applicant will ideally have in excess of twelve months post qualification experience in Employment law (or more than one traditional seat during training). The company requires candidates with either a non contentious or contentious bias, so if your interest lies in drafting work or advocacy there is an opportunity for you. Their clients will then benefit from your experience, knowledge, confidence and skills in giving quality, practical and pragmatic advice across the whole spectrum of Employment Law issues.
This is an excellent opportunity to join a truly different and individual organisation at an exciting time in their development. The company is a great believer in the lighter side of life and has a vibrant and active social scene.
Salary (guideline up to £35k) and extensive benefits will be commensurate with experience.
